    Abstract: An object of the present invention is to obtain an image that is more similar to a real ink-wash painting. An ink-wash painting conversion unit converts data of an original image into data of a painterly image. A characteristic region detection unit detects a characteristic region of the original image from the data of the original image. A conversion unit executes gradation processing of gradating the characteristic region detected by the characteristic region detection unit, and margin setting processing of setting a margin region to be added to the painterly image, as image processing of further converting the data of the painterly image that was converted by the ink-wash painting conversion unit.

    Abstract: An image processing apparatus of the present invention acquires a photographed image of an object on which indicators have been arranged, detects the indicators from the photographed image with use of a comparison reference image for pattern matching prepared in advance, and instructs to perform predetermined processing based on the detected indicators. The indicators each have a pattern where influence of geometrical image distortion generated corresponding to a photographing distance or a photographing angle with respect to the object is restrained by a central portion of the photographed image, and the comparison reference image is a partial image corresponding to a central portion of the indicator. The indicators are detected from the photographed image by comparing the comparison reference image with the acquired photographed image.

    Abstract: A threshold setting device, an object detection device, a threshold setting method, and a computer readable storage medium are shown. According to one implementation, the threshold setting device includes, an image acquisition unit, a ratio acquisition unit, and a setting unit. The image acquisition unit acquires an image including a specific object. The ratio acquisition unit acquires ratio information related to a ratio of a plurality of colors present in the specific object. The setting unit sets, based on the ratio information acquired by the ratio acquisition unit, a threshold used in a binarization process performed on the image including the specific object acquired by the image acquisition unit.

    Abstract: The present invention improves the recognition rate of an augmented reality marker and the processing speed thereof, simultaneously. In the present invention, a CPU binarizes actual image captured in an image sensor in accordance with an adaptive thresholding, and detects an augmented reality marker from within the binarized image. Then, the CPU determines a binarization threshold based on the augmented reality marker, and after binarizing the actual image captured in the image sensor in accordance with a fixed threshold binarization method using the binarization threshold, recognizes the augmented reality marker based on the binarized image.
